A straightforward sans with open, rounded forms and smooth curves paired with crisp, squared terminals. Strokes are even and consistent, with generous counters and clear apertures that keep the texture airy in paragraphs. Proportions are balanced and modern, with a calm rhythm and minimal stylistic quirks; the uppercase reads sturdy and neutral while the lowercase stays simple and legible.
Well suited for UI text, product copy, signage, presentations, and editorial body text where a calm, modern sans is needed. It also works effectively for charts, dashboards, and technical or corporate communications that benefit from straightforward letterforms and a clean paragraph color.
This typeface feels clean, contemporary, and matter-of-fact. The overall tone is friendly but restrained, with a quiet efficiency that suits informational and interface-driven contexts rather than expressive or ornamental ones.
The design appears intended to provide dependable, unobtrusive readability with a contemporary sans voice. It prioritizes clarity through open shapes, consistent stroke behavior, and restrained detailing so it can serve as a default typographic workhorse across many settings.
The sample text shows steady spacing and a smooth paragraph gray, aided by open apertures (notably in letters like e, c, and s) and simple, unembellished construction. Numerals appear plain and easy to distinguish, matching the overall neutral character.
